The anticipation surrounding the OnePlus 13 Mini, expected to be released in 2025, has tech enthusiasts buzzing about its potential to revolutionize compact smartphone battery life. Despite its smaller screen size compared to full-sized flagship devices, the OnePlus 13 Mini is expected to feature an impressive 6,000mAh battery. This is a remarkable achievement, given that the flagship OnePlus 13, with its larger 6.82-inch display, houses the same battery capacity. OnePlus aims to combine top-tier performance with a more manageable form factor, addressing the increasing consumer desire for powerful yet compact smartphones.

In the rapidly evolving smartphone market, manufacturers like OnePlus, Vivo, and Oppo are striving to offer devices that do not compromise on performance due to their smaller size. This trend is evident in the upcoming OnePlus 13 Mini, which competes with models such as the 6.36-inch Xiaomi 15, equipped with a 5,400mAh battery. One key aspect that demonstrates the ingenuity of the OnePlus 13 Mini is its ability to house a battery that rivals the larger flagship models while maintaining a minimalistic design. Additionally, there is speculation that the OnePlus 13 Mini could share design cues and specifications with the rumored Oppo Find X8 Mini, albeit with different chipsets.

Interestingly, the potential for the OnePlus 13 Mini to be rebranded as the OnePlus 13T adds another layer of intrigue. It speaks to the brand’s strategy of providing users with multiple options that cater to varying preferences. Future iterations of compact smartphones are expected to push boundaries even further, with battery capacities potentially reaching 6,500mAh or 7,000mAh by late 2025 or early 2026.
